Descrição da oferta de emprego

About Datamentors Datamentors is building the next generation of autonomous robotics through a combination of advanced AI, robotics, and proprietary Vision-Language-Action (VLA) models. Our mission is to create intelligent robotic systems capable of understanding natural language, reasoning about the world, and acting autonomously in complex environments.

We are assembling a world-class engineering team to tackle some of the hardest challenges in robotics, AI, perception, and autonomy. The engineers who join us today will have a direct impact on the core technologies that power Ardia and the future of intelligent machines

Role Overview Own the post-training stage of the Ardia humanoid platform - taking pretrained, behaviour-cloned Vision-Language-Action policies and systematically lifting their success rate, precision, and robustness through RL fine-tuning, reward modelling, and a tight sim-to-real loop. This hands-on leadership role sets the technical direction for RL across the platform, builds the training and evaluation infrastructure, and grows a small team around it. You'll be the person who turns a capable-but-inconsistent humanoid into a dependable one. The difference between a research demo and a product.

Responsabilities
  • Post-VLA RL fine-tuning - design and run the pipeline that takes a pretrained/imitation-learned VLA policy and improves it with reinforcement learning (online and offline RL, RLHF/RL-from-feedback, preference and reward-model approaches) to lift task success rates and reduce failure modes.
  • Reward design & evaluation - define reward signals, success criteria, and automated evaluation harnesses that actually correlate with real-world manipulation and whole-body performance, and that catch regressions before deployment.
  • Sim-to-real - build and tune the simulation-to-hardware transfer loop (domain randomization, residual policies, real-world fine-tuning) so gains in simulation hold up on the physical robot.
  • Data flywheel - establish the loop that turns robot rollouts and teleop data into better policies: autonomous data collection, filtering, labelling, and continual retraining.
  • Integration across the stack - work with the teams owning the orchestration layer, the VLA policy, and whole-body control so RL improvements compose cleanly rather than fighting the rest of the system.
  • Technical leadership - set the RL roadmap, make build-vs-adopt calls on frameworks and tooling, mentor engineers, and represent the work to the wider team and external partners.
Requirements
  • Strong, demonstrable RL expertise: PPO/GRPO and related policy-gradient methods, offline RL, RLHF/preference-based RL, and reward modelling - you understand where each breaks and why.
  • Robot learning / embodied AI experience - ideally hands-on with VLA models (e.G. OpenVLA, π0, GR00T-class, or comparable manipulation/locomotion policies).
  • Practical sim-to-real experience and fluency with at least one major simulator (Isaac Lab / Isaac Gym, MuJoCo, or similar).
  • Solid ML engineering: PyTorch, distributed training, GPU-efficient pipelines, and the discipline to build reproducible experiments and rigorous evaluation.
  • Evidence of shipping - you've taken a policy from "works in a demo" to "works reliable," not just published benchmarks.
Nice to have
  • Direct experience with humanoid or whole-body control (locomotion + manipulation), and with the realities of training on real hardware.
  • Familiarity with VLA post-training specifically - fine-tuning, distillation, or RL on top of large pretrained action models.
  • Comfort working close to perception (vision, point clouds) and to low-level control.
  • Open-source contributions to robot learning or RL frameworks.
  • Experience standing up data-collection / teleoperation pipelines.
  • Publications or applied work at the VLA / robot-learning frontier (ICRA / CoRL / RSS-level).
